Why These Are the Top Restoration Contractors in Brownwood

The restoration market in Brownwood, Texas, is characterized by a stable level of competition primarily dominated by a few well-established national franchises. These providers have a strong local presence and are equipped to handle the most common local disasters, including water damage from plumbing failures, storm and hail damage from Central Texas weather patterns, and fire damage. The average quality of service is high, as these franchises operate under strict corporate protocols and require technicians to hold IICRC (Institute of Inspection, Cleaning and Restoration Certification) certifications. Pricing is typically not advertised and is based on industry-standard pricing software like Xactimate, which is widely accepted by insurance carriers. Most major providers in the area offer 24/7 emergency dispatch and have deep expertise in navigating insurance claims, making them partners in the recovery process rather than just contractors. Consumers in Brownwood have access to reputable, professional services without needing to look outside the city limits.

1How quickly should I respond to water damage in my Brownwood home, and are there seasonal risks I should know about?

Immediate response is critical, ideally within 24-48 hours, to prevent mold growth and structural damage. In Brownwood, seasonal risks include heavy spring thunderstorms that can cause roof leaks and flooding, as well as potential pipe issues during occasional winter freezes. The local humidity can also accelerate mold growth, making prompt professional drying essential.

2What should I look for when choosing a fire and smoke damage restoration company in Brownwood?

Choose a provider licensed by the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R) and certified by the IICRC. Look for a local company with 24/7 emergency response, as they understand Brownwood's building styles and materials. Verify they handle both the soot/odor removal and the often-overlooked water damage from firefighting efforts, which is a complete restoration approach.

3Are restoration costs in Brownwood typically covered by homeowners insurance, and what is my role in the process?

Most standard homeowners policies in Texas cover sudden, accidental damage like burst pipes or storm-related issues. Your role is to mitigate further damage (e.g., stopping the water flow) and document everything with photos before cleanup begins. Always contact your insurance provider immediately to understand your deductible and coverage specifics, as policies can vary.

4How does the local climate in Brownwood affect mold remediation, and is it a common issue here?

Mold is a very common issue due to Brownwood's climate, which features high humidity, especially in spring and summer, and significant rainfall. Effective remediation must address the source moisture (like a leaky AC unit or foundation seepage) and include professional drying and antimicrobial treatments. Without fixing the moisture source, mold will likely return quickly in this environment.

5What are the key local considerations for storm and wind damage restoration specific to the Brown County area?

Brownwood is in a region prone to severe thunderstorms, hail, and occasional tornadoes. Local considerations include repairing roofs with materials that meet Texas windstorm building codes for potential insurance discounts, and addressing water intrusion that often accompanies wind damage. A reputable local contractor will be familiar with common storm damage patterns on local homes and can navigate any specific city of Brownwood permitting requirements for major repairs.
